随机舍入工具箱:MATLAB 工具箱,用于 IEEE 754 浮点算法中的随机舍入基本算术运算。-matlab开发

时间:2024-06-20 18:08:13
【文件属性】:

文件名称:随机舍入工具箱:MATLAB 工具箱,用于 IEEE 754 浮点算法中的随机舍入基本算术运算。-matlab开发

文件大小:5KB

文件格式:ZIP

更新时间:2024-06-20 18:08:13

matlab

随机舍入工具箱是一组 MATLAB 函数,用于在符合 IEEE 标准的硬件上模拟随机舍入。 工具箱中的函数模拟四个基本算术运算的随机舍入。 提供了以下例程: 1. 初等算术运算* sradd:加法 [Alg. 4.1, 1] * sradd2:快速添加[Alg. 4.2, 1] * srmulfma:使用 FMA 的乘法 [Alg. 4.3, 1] * srdiv:除法 [Alg. 4.5, 1] 2. 健壮的界面* srop:对上述所有内容进行参数检查。 3. 实用功能* twosum:增广求和 [Alg. 4.4, 2] * twoprodfma:增强产品 [Alg. 4.8,2] 1. 中的函数不检查输入参数,因此效率更高但鲁棒性较差。 2. 中的接口检查所有输入参数是否有效,因此速度较慢。 所有函数都是矢量化的。 参考 [1] M. Fasi 和 M. Mikaitis


【文件预览】:
github_repo.zip

网友评论